Benjamin Bodner is a Shareholder and a member of Hinman Straub’s Life Insurance and Health Insurance Departments, focusing his practice mainly on regulatory and corporate matters. With particular expertise in life insurance and health insurance compliance issues, Mr. Bodner brings over twenty years of experience in the insurance industry to the firm’s clients.

Mr. Bodner represents over twenty commercial insurance carriers before the New York State Department of Financial Services, assisting them with the design, filing, and approval process for health insurance, life insurance, and annuity products. He supports insurance carriers, agencies, and individual agents in complying with all aspects of insurance and corporate law and regulation, in addition to assisting with market conduct examinations and disciplinary actions.

Mr. Bodner also represents service contract providers and a national service contract trade association in New York, providing both regulatory and government relations services. Mr. Bodner recently leveraged his prior experience in Hinman Straub’s Government Relations/Lobbying practice to secure several legislative changes benefitting service contract providers in New York.

Mr. Bodner’s practice also encompasses the management of corporate workplace and employment matters, from counseling on general business matters including employer/employee relationships, to representing both employers and employees before regulatory agencies including the Justice Center for the Protection of People with Special Needs. Mr. Bodner develops both proactive and reactive strategies for employers and employees, maximizing results while minimizing costs and exposures.
